WebJan 1, 2024 · Key Takeaways. Bleed is one of the three Auxiliary effects Darks Souls 3 offers. It is offered by a lot of weapons. Carthus Curved Greatsword can achieve up to 99 bleed after reinforcement by titanite, infusion by blood gem, and 40 Luck. Its weapon art is Spin Slash. It is dropped by Graven Warden Skeletons in the Catacombs of Carthus. WebFeb 3, 2024 · Hollow infusion=more damage on each hit but less build up and damage when it procs. WebApr 18, 2016 · Infusion gems are materials used to infuse weapons in Dark Souls 3. They let you change the type of damage your weapon does, but also influence the attribute scaling levels.
